In environments where manual operation is impractical or unsafe, voice-activated communication technology has emerged as a transformative solution. VOX (Voice-Operated eXchange) functionality represents a significant advancement in two-way radio systems, eliminating the need for physical push-to-talk (PTT) buttons and enabling truly hands-free operation.

Effective VOX operation requires careful configuration:
Sensitivity Calibration: Optimal threshold settings balance between false activations from ambient noise and reliable voice detection. Modern systems typically offer 3-5 adjustable sensitivity levels.
Audio Processing: Advanced models incorporate noise-cancellation algorithms and voice recognition patterns to minimize accidental transmissions while maintaining clear audio quality.
Accessory Compatibility: Specialized headsets with boom microphones often provide superior performance compared to built-in radio microphones, particularly in high-noise environments.
